    Joey Moi. Lyric video. "Livin' the Dream" on YouTube. " Livin' the Dream " is a song recorded by American country music singer Morgan Wallen. It was released on November 20, 2020 from his second studio album Dangerous: The Double Album. [1] The song was co-wrote by Wallen, Michael Hardy, Ben Burgess and Jacob Durrett, and produced by Joey Moi.

    Boutique. Opened. 1974. Closed. 1976. Sex (stylised SEX) was a boutique run by Vivienne Westwood and her then partner Malcolm McLaren at 430 King's Road, London between 1974 and 1976. It specialised in clothing that defined the look of the punk movement. [1] Westwood and McLaren’s boutique underwent several name and correlating interior decor ...

    La Boutique fantasque, also known as The Magic Toyshop [1] or The Fantastic Toyshop, is a ballet in one act conceived by Léonide Massine, who devised the choreography for a libretto written with the artist André Derain, a pioneer of Fauvism. Derain also designed the décor and costumes for the ballet. [2]
